Dry Suit Diver

The Dry Suit Diver Course is designed to teach you to dive safely and stay warm and dry. A dry-suit will extend your ability to do multiple dives in temperate waters. It isn't uncommon to see wet-suit divers on a live-aboard call it a day after 2 dives, whilst the dry-suit divers are still going strong after 4 or 5 dives.
